Processing 200,000 tokens can correspond to analyzing hundreds of pages of text in a single request.
Expanding context windows introduces technical challenges in memory allocation and attention computation. Claude 3 supports up to 200,000 tokens, enabling full-length contract or manuscript review. Engineering refinements address attention scaling to prevent degradation in reasoning accuracy at high token counts. Public documentation emphasizes maintaining coherence across lengthy documents. The measurable improvement lies in sustained accuracy and reduced error rates under long-input testing. Context engineering now forms a competitive differentiator among frontier models. Efficient long-context handling requires hardware-software co-optimization. Claude’s architecture reflects investment in extended document reasoning.

Legal and research institutions benefit from the ability to analyze entire documents in a single prompt. Reduced need for manual segmentation streamlines compliance workflows. Cloud infrastructure providers adapt resource allocation to accommodate long-context usage. Competitive markets increasingly highlight maximum context capacity as a headline feature. Extended context shifts enterprise integration patterns.
Users experience fewer interruptions when working with comprehensive materials. Developers design workflows that embed large documents directly into prompts. The psychological expectation of continuity grows with context expansion. Artificial systems begin to approximate full-document reviewers. Stability under scale reinforces enterprise confidence.
